Frequently asked questions about Amity Creek Elementary School
How many students attend Amity Creek Elementary School?
Amity Creek Elementary School has 144 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Bend, OR. CCD year-over-year: 147 (2022-23) → 142 (2023-24), nearly flat (-5).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Amity Creek Elementary School?
The student-teacher ratio at Amity Creek Elementary School is 24:1, which is 36% higher than the Oregon average of 17.6:1 and 53% higher than the national average of 15.7:1.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Amity Creek Elementary School?
7.5% of students at Amity Creek Elementary School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Oregon average of 52.8%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Amity Creek Elementary School?
The largest demographic group at Amity Creek Elementary School is White at 90.3% of enrollment, in Bend, OR.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Amity Creek Elementary School?
Amity Creek Elementary School has a Resource Investment Index of 30/100 (lower re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 3 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, chronic absenteeism.
